Architect® Blue Keypad & Biometrics
The Architect® Blue biometric reader enhances the security of your access control system and provides strong multi-factor authentication by combining open MIFARE® DESFire® EV3 technologies, a capacitive keypad and a fingerprint sensor.
Highly Versatile
The reader supports the widest range of credential technologies, including 13.56 MHz DESFire® EV3, STid Mobile ID® instinctive identification modes (Tap Tap, Remote…) via native Bluetooth® and Near Field Communication (NFC) capability. It also features Apple’s Enhanced Contactless Polling (ECP) to store credentials in the Apple Wallet.
Effortless Fingerprint Control
The biometric reader offers a different options to suit your needs:
• Fingerprint templates stored on the RFID card, ensuring compliance with CNIL French and GDPR European legislation.
• Templates stored within the system.
• Biometric exemption with card-only mode, using RFID card or the convenience of smartphone biometric unlocking, ideal for one-time visitors or individuals with challenging fingerprints.
Advanced Anti-Spoof Functions
The biometric reader is designed to resist fraud and spoof attempts:
• False finger detection: the reader detects a wide range of counterfeit fingerprints made of latex, Kapton, transparent film, rubber, graphite, etc.
• Detection of live fingers.
• Duress finger: the admin can assign a
finger number dedicated to authentication when the user is threatened.
Strong Multi-Factor Authentication
The reader combines the reading of a secure MIFARE® DESFire® EV3 credential with fingerprint identification and PIN entry to enhance security levels.
Fingerprints are converted into a template, meaning no image is ever saved. Templates stored on the card or server are then also encrypted and signed to guarantee the confidentiality, the origin and the integrity of the data.
